Patricia “Patty” “Pat” Howard, 85, went to be with her loving Savior and Lord Jesus Christ on Sunday, October 25, 2020. Pat is preceded in death by her father and mother, Arthur & Terrell Darbaker, her brother James Darbaker, and her stepmother Mercedes (Chapman) Darbaker. She is survived by her husband of 43 years, James Howard; her children Kathy (Jeff) Dunn, Leslie (Jerry) Sharkey, and John (Darcy) Riner; her stepchildren Karen (Tommy) Hiatt and Stephanie Brookshire; her grandchildren Rebekah (Chris) Cypert, Leah (Ty) Wolfe, Mark Dunn, Matthew Sharkey, Christina (Ben) Ellison, Anita (Mat) Stasuk, Alec Riner, Joel Riner, Wesley Willis, Jake Willis, Rachel (Jim) Mayes, and Amy (Damien) Bentley; her great-grandchildren Lex, Satchel, Saylor, and Harvey Cypert, Jude, Amelie, and Gabriel Wolfe, Lydia and Julian Stasuk, Elijah May and Ethan Mayes. Pat’s greatest passion was her love for Jesus and His Word and work in her life and the lives of her family and friends. She wanted everyone to know and experience forgiveness and salvation through Jesus, for there is “no other name by which we are saved.”
Pat graduated from Lancaster High School, attended the University of Cincinnati for Advertising Art, received her Bachelor’s degree in Educational Media from Wright State University, and her Master’s degree in Library Science from Kent State University. She was a faithful member and librarian for 53 years at Cross Point Vineyard Church in Centerville, where she influenced many people through her prayers and encouragement. Pat volunteered for the Centerville & Springboro Historical Societies, taught Sunday School, and enjoyed reading, scrapbooking, playing the piano, gardening, and spending time with her grandchildren and great-grandchildren. She stayed fit by walking and through her water aerobics classes, where she had many special friends.
